In this workshop, you will learn the basics of hand mending old rags, and then use a sewing machine to create a pencil case from mended scraps.
From darning, sewing buttons and patching, to following a pattern and making a finished item – this class takes you through all the basic skills to fix up (and maybe start to make) your own clothes.
What will be covered in this mending workshop?
  • Darning and embroidery to fix tears and holes
  • Colour matching, visible mending
  • Sewing machine set up and safety
  • Pattern assembly
  • Pinning and stitching
  • Button attachment
By the end of this mending workshop, you should be able to:
  • Know several tools and stitches needed to darn and patch a hole in fabric by hand – based on what kind of damage the fabric has attained.
  • Assemble the components of a basic sewing pattern
  • Set up and use a sewing machine
  • Basic stitching for lining and assembly on a home sewing machine
